Transaction 65342053378677046b53cd41389c5669475e54a3d3b376a1d6255b0f5180bf94

2 Input
2 Outputs
  • 65342053378677046b53cd41389c5669475e54a3d3b376a1d6255b0f5180bf94:0
  • value  3289299
    address  bc1q4xhcy3dafadguk89f9q7pm27ccft6q9zufhhyh
  • 65342053378677046b53cd41389c5669475e54a3d3b376a1d6255b0f5180bf94:1
  • value  5000000
    address  32onGGacL6J7okCmspN9pfkwVwzVb7ETjZ